Conformance Status

We aim to conform with the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 Level AA. These guidelines explain how to make web content more accessible to people with disabilities. The following measures are in place:

  • All form inputs have associated labels
  • Color is not used as the only means of conveying information — results include text labels alongside color indicators
  • Interactive elements have visible focus indicators
  • The application can be navigated using a keyboard alone
  • Text meets a 4.5:1 contrast ratio against backgrounds for normal text
  • Charts include text-based results alongside visual representations

Known Limitations

We are aware of the following areas that may not fully meet WCAG 2.1 AA at this time:

  • Chart components (Recharts) may not expose all data through accessible ARIA attributes. All key numerical results are presented in text form as well.
  • Some complex interactive charts may not be fully operable by screen reader users. We provide the same information in text-based result cards.
